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Acle to Midgham start from as little as £23.50

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Acle to Midgham start from £95.10 one way, or £96.10 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Acle to Midgham are available for £137.70 one way, or £210.10 return

Station Facilities and Amenities

Acle Train Station, while compact, is well-equipped to facilitate a smooth traveling experience. Even though it lacks a formal ticket office, passengers can easily access ticket machines to collect tickets, including those purchased online. These machines are fully accessible, making it simple for everyone to manage their travel documentation with ease.

For added convenience, passengers seeking information can use the station’s help point. Customer information is available through departure screens and announcements, ensuring that travelers remain updated on their journeys. Although the station does not offer luggage storage or lost property services, passengers can rest assured with CCTV surveillance enhancing station security.

Accessibility Features

Step-free access is available for part of the journey through Acle Train Station. This is especially useful for travelers heading towards Great Yarmouth as there is direct step-free access from the car park to Platform 2. Those wishing to travel towards Norwich have to navigate a stepped footbridge, but alternatively, an access path from Reedham Road is available, though it spans approximately 250 meters. Passengers needing assistance can rely on the Passenger Assist service, providing comprehensive help for onward journeys with prior booking.

Transport Links to and from Acle Station

Rail replacement buses are conveniently stationed in front of the nearby police station on Norwich Road, providing an alternative travel option when necessary. Facilities and Accessibility at Midgham Station

While Midgham station may not boast a large ticket office, it does provide ticket machines, allowing travelers to effortlessly collect tickets bought online. Accessibility is prioritized with step-free access available to both platforms via a level crossing, and for those who need additional assistance, accessible ticket machines and induction loops are readily available.

The station's practical approach extends beyond easy ticketing services. It offers free parking with 12 spaces and CCTV security, allowing passengers to leave their vehicles with peace of mind. Cyclists are also catered to, with two Sheffield hoops available, although there are no cycle hire facilities.

Although not equipped with refreshment facilities or public Wi-Fi, the station incorporates other essential features such as payphones and CCTV, further ensuring traveler convenience and security. It's also important to note that there are no toilets or waiting rooms, so passengers may need to plan accordingly.

Onward Travel Options

Midgham serves as a connective hub with several travel options. For those looking to move on to other modes of transport, onward journey planning is straightforward. There are rail replacement services available nearby at The Angel pub on Bath Rd (A4), should disruptions arise. For air travelers, connections are made easy with options to change at Reading for the RailAir road link to Heathrow or at Hayes & Harlington for the Elizabeth Line service to Heathrow.
